为残奥运动中的分级目的评估肌肉力量:一项综述与建议。

Assessing muscle strength for the purpose of classification in Paralympic sport: A review and recommendations.

Abstract

OBJECTIVES

Classification in Paralympic Sport aims to minimize the impact of 10 eligible types of impairment on the outcome of competition. Methods for assessing the extent to which a given body structure or function has been impaired are required, but are challenging because it is not possible to directly measure an absence or loss. Rather, impairment must be inferred by measurement of extant body structures or functions.

METHODS

This manuscript reviews the literature concerning the assessment of strength with the aim of identifying and describing the most appropriate method for inferring strength impairment in para-athletes.

RESULTS

It is posited that the most appropriate voluntary strength assessment method for inferring strength loss in para-athletes will be multi-joint, isometric tests performed at joint angles that facilitate maximum force production.

CONCLUSIONS

Evidence suggests such methods will permit development of tests that are specific to a variety of para-sports and which are reliable, ratio-scaled, and resistant to training. Future research should: develop sport-specific tests which are suitable for assessment of athletes with strength impairments of variable severity and distribution; and scientifically evaluate the extent to which such tests permit strength impairment to be validly inferred, including specific evaluation of the extent to which such measures respond to athletic training.

摘要

目的

残奥会运动中的分级旨在尽量减少10种符合条件的损伤类型对比赛结果的影响。需要评估特定身体结构或功能受损程度的方法,但这具有挑战性,因为无法直接测量缺失或丧失情况。相反,必须通过测量现存的身体结构或功能来推断损伤情况。

方法

本手稿回顾了有关力量评估的文献,目的是识别和描述推断残疾运动员力量损伤的最合适方法。

结果

据推测,推断残疾运动员力量丧失的最合适的自愿力量评估方法将是在有助于产生最大力量的关节角度进行的多关节等长测试。

结论

有证据表明,这些方法将有助于开发针对各种残疾人运动项目的测试,这些测试可靠、具有比率尺度且不受训练影响。未来的研究应:开发适合评估具有不同严重程度和分布的力量损伤运动员的特定运动项目测试;并科学评估此类测试在多大程度上能够有效推断力量损伤,包括具体评估此类测量对运动训练的反应程度。
